Remplir un champs automatiquement

Répondre


Cette question est un moyen d’empêcher des soumissions automatisées de formulaires par des robots.
Smileys
:D :) :( :o :shock: :? 8-) :lol: :x :P :oops: :cry: :evil: :twisted: :roll: :wink: :!: :?: :idea: :arrow: :| :mrgreen: =D> #-o =P~ :^o :non: :priere: 8-|
Voir plus de smileys
  Revue du sujet
 

  Étendre la vue Revue du sujet : Remplir un champs automatiquement

par lulumOriss » 08 sept. 2005, 10:49

C'est parfait, ça marche parfaitement.
Merci beaucoup.

"Résolu" et hop !

par Truc » 08 sept. 2005, 00:10

avec un truc du genre (pas testé mais ca doit etre bon):

script:
function total()
{	
var champ1=document.NomFormulaire.Champ1.value;
var champ2=document.NomFormulaire.Champ2.value;
....
document.NomFormulaire.Total.value=parseFloat(champ1) + parseFloat(champ2);
}	
Formulaire:
<FORM NAME="NomFormulaire" >
   <input type="text" name="Champ1" value=0 onkeyup="total()">
   <input type="text" name="Champ2" value=0 onkeyup="total()">
    ...
   <input type="text" name="Total">
 ...

par albat » 07 sept. 2005, 21:02

en appelant à partir de l'évènement onChange
une fonction de ta création qui lance le recalcul des autres champs,
ce devrait être possible...

Remplir un champs automatiquement

par lulumOriss » 07 sept. 2005, 17:47

Bonjour,

Dans un formulaire, j'ai plusieurs champs de saisie dans lesquels l'utilisateur doit entrer des nombres décimaux.

Je souhaite que, lorsqu'il effectue la saisie, un autre champs affiche le résultat de l'addition de tous les autres champs et, ceci en même temps qu'il entre les infos.

Possible ?

Merci de vos réponses. lulu.